Sevaldric says, "Hail, friend! My name is Sevaldric and I reside here in Jordheim. I must admit though, I am a well [traveled] dwarf."

Sevaldric says, "I have a liking for import ales. One of my favorites is Albion's Prayer House Ale. They have so much more flavor than the domestic ale we get here in Midgard. The ale here tends to be watered down in comparison. It is of lesser quality and just not [satisfying] to my palette."

Sevaldric says, "To my sheer delight, The Teetering Tomte has taken my advice and has begun a new brewing process which has produced quality ale similar to my beloved imports. Now after enjoying this, when traveling within Midgard, I am subject to drinking that [horrid] domestic ale."

Sevaldric says, "I had a grand idea to petition the King and have him require all breweries to use a standard method, so the quality is equal across the realm. I even brought the King some of this ale to try, as I know he loves ale like any good Midgard citizen. My only problem is that I forgot something while in my rush to present my grand idea. I need something for him to compare it with."

Are you willing to help Sevaldric so all of Midgard can drink quality ale?"
You have been given the Telltale Ale quest. [Level 50]


Sevaldric says, "Wonderful, another ale lover. Well I have [two ideas] of how to convince the King besides the keg I brought."

Sevaldric says, "I think I should either present him with a [keg] of one of these lesser quality ales or with the new [recipe] The Teetering Tomte is using for their brew. Which do you suggest?"

Sevaldric says, "Go speak with Banak in The Teetering Tomte. He was the mastermind behind this new brewing process. He will have a recipe we can show the King. This will also save the King time in tracking down how to make the marvelous ale for the other breweries. Hurry back as it is almost my turn."

[Step #2] Go to the Teetering Tomte and speak with Banak. He created the new brew and will have a [copy] of the recipe.

Barkeep Banak says, "Welcome to The Teetering Tomte! What may I get you, Healer?"

You tell Banak of Sevaldric's idea and that he requests a [copy] of his brewing recipe for his ale.

Barkeep Banak says, "I am not so sure I wish to do that. Why would I want to share my recipe with everyone and possibly lose customers to the other taverns."

You try to persuade him by telling him maybe they would [name the ale] after him or he would even get profits for the use of his recipe.

Barkeep Banak says, "Well if they named it after me everyone would know who made it and I would be ok with that. You will have to ask Sevaldric about [profits] for me though."

Barkeep Banak says, "Here is a copy of the recipe I used. If you notice, I wrote the name down too, Banak?s Brew. Tell Sevaldric to visit me after he has spoken with King Eirik."

You receive the Recipe for Banak's Brew from Barkeep Banak!

[Step #3] Return to the throne room and speak with Sevaldric.

Sevaldric says, "You have made it back just in the knick of time as I am about to [speak] with the King."

Sevaldric says, "Do you have Banak's recipe for his amazing ale? Please hand it to me."

Sevaldric says, "Seems he named it after himself, Banak's Brew. He deserves that as he is a genius if you ask me. I will see if the King will [compensate] him for this as well."

Sevaldric says, "Seems I also owe you some compensation for your assistance. Please take this reward as my thanks. You have helped me immensely and hopefully all of Midgard will be thankful as well."

You are awarded 10 gold!
You have earned 800 champion experience!
You are awarded 1,600,000,000 experience!
